WASHINGTON - President of the United States (U.S.), Barack Obama expressed his congratulations to Prince William and his wife Kate Middleton on their marriage and wish them a happy life.

White House spokesman, Jay Carney said the U.S. government said in a statement said that the UK is the best companion, where President Barack Obama is expected to make a visit next month.

"We congratulate the marriage between Prince William and Catherine Middleton, Duke and Duchess of Cambridge, and we pray for happiness in their lives together.

"On this occasion, all the American people sincerely congratulate the people of Britain and the Commonwealth, and expect a good future for both the royal couple are," Carney said as quoted by the Associated Press on Sunday (01/05/2011).

LONDON - Prince William and his wife, Princess Kate, decided to postpone their honeymoon because William had to go back to work immediately on Tuesday next week.

William and Kate did not immediately disclose to travel overseas to tradition that used to do after getting married and prefer to spend the weekend at one in England before William went back to work next Tuesday.

The changes are conducted in a sudden, even though the aide in court has been told by certain princes and princesses honeymoon soon after marriage. She was rumored to have bought a few clothes in preparation for the honeymoon last week.

There was speculation the changes caused by security problems. The new royal couple is rumored to have planned a honeymoon trip to Jordan, where she had lived for two years there. However, the security risks that threaten the Middle East region as a result of the riots makes the couple to reconsider their plans.

"Duke and Duchess of Cambridge has decided to immediately implement their honeymoon trip. In fact, after spending the weekend in England, the Prince would soon return to work as a pilot in the Royal Air Force (RAF) next Tuesday, "said one spokesman for the Palace of St. James as reported by the Telegraph, Sunday (01/05/2011).

The spokesperson added that the location where the prince and princess spent the weekend and where they will honeymoon will not be disclosed further. However, the new bride certainly does not spend weekends at their home in Anglesey.

William and Kate are expected to honeymoon in the month before their tour to Canada in July.
